Whole-school updates

  • Principal's Message: It's Week 7 and the sun is shining, bringing smiles and outdoor play! Learning is full steam ahead, and staff and students are loving the new daily maths warmups, which are already showing amazing improvements in thinking.
  • Sporting Success: Shout out to a student who represented the school at the Sapsasa State Boys AFL Carnival, with their team placing 7th. Another student represented the USE at Cross Country in Oakbank, achieving an impressive time despite challenging conditions. Great work!
  • Walk to School Day: A huge thank you to Lisa for organizing a successful Walk to School Day, and to Ellen for providing a fantastic second breakfast. It was wonderful to see so many students walking or riding in, even bus students joined the fun!
  • Jam Band Performance: Students enjoyed a fantastic Jam Band concert with lots of audience participation and movement, even getting to be part of the show! Thanks to Sunrise Christian School for the invitation.
  • Assembly: Congratulations to the 2 students who received recent assembly awards. Our next assembly is on Thursday 2 July at 2:30pm, offering families a chance to see the wonderful work happening in classrooms.
  • Active Storytime & Library: Tara will be back on Friday 19 June for another Active Storytime session, bringing the mobile library for students to borrow new books. Last week's "Eat the rainbow" theme was a hit, and we can't wait to see the next colour!
